History
A concise historical narrative of NAICS Code 424690-18 covering global milestones and recent developments within the United States.
- The "Carbonic Gas (Wholesale)" industry has a long history dating back to the 18th century when carbon dioxide was first discovered. The gas was initially used in the production of carbonated beverages, and later on, it found its way into the medical industry as an anesthetic. In the 20th century, the industry experienced significant growth due to the increased demand for carbon dioxide in the food and beverage industry. The gas was used to preserve food, carbonate beverages, and as a refrigerant. In recent years, the industry has continued to grow due to the increased demand for carbon dioxide in the oil and gas industry, where it is used in the extraction of oil and gas from wells. In the United States, the industry has experienced steady growth due to the increased demand for carbon dioxide in the food and beverage industry, as well as the oil and gas industry.
